What Type of Medicine is Galusan?

Galusan is the name associated with a medicine whose active ingredient is Pipemidic Acid, a synthetic antibiotic belonging to the quinolone class of antimicrobial agents.

This classification identifies the medicine's fundamental role: it is designed to fight infections caused by susceptible bacteria. As a specific type of quinolone, Pipemidic Acid is recognized in pharmacological studies for its effectiveness against a wide range of common Gram-negative bacteria, which are often involved in infections of the urinary or gastrointestinal tracts. This evidence supports its established utility as an anti-infective agent.

What side effects are possible with Galusan?

Possible Side Effects and Safety Information

The safety profile of Galusan (Pipemidic Acid) is governed by its classification as a quinolone antibacterial agent. The marketing authorization for medicines containing this active substance has been suspended by regulatory bodies such as the European Medicines Agency (EMA) due to the risk of serious, disabling, and potentially permanent side effects.

Serious Adverse Reactions (Very Rare Reports)

Official regulatory sources emphasize the potential for adverse reactions that are classified as disabling, long-lasting (up to months or years), and potentially irreversible. These very rarely reported effects involve multiple body systems:

  • Musculoskeletal and Connective Tissue Disorders: Tendinitis, tendon rupture (especially the Achilles tendon), arthralgia (joint pain), and muscle pain.
  • Nervous System Disorders: Peripheral neuropathies (e.g., persistent pain, burning, tingling, or weakness) and Central Nervous System (CNS) effects, including dizziness, confusion, depression, memory impairment, and severe sleep disorders.
  • Special Senses: Impairment of vision, hearing, taste, and smell.

Safety Patterns and Restrictions

The following safety characteristics are officially documented:

Classification Detail
Time-Related Pattern Tendon damage may occur within 48 hours of starting treatment or be delayed several months after stopping treatment.
High-Risk Populations Older adults (over 60), patients with renal impairment, and organ transplant recipients are at higher risk for tendon injury.
Safety Restriction Co-administration with corticosteroids is officially advised against due to the significantly increased risk of tendon damage.

Overdose and Emergency Response

The official regulatory profile for Galusan (Pipemidic Acid) overdose addresses the risk of acute, severe complications that necessitate immediate medical intervention. Documented overdose presentations primarily involve Central Nervous System (CNS) Effects, including tremor, restlessness, agitation, and confusion. Gastrointestinal effects such as nausea and vomiting may also occur following the absorption of a massive dose.

Life-threatening outcomes documented for this drug class include severe CNS effects, such as convulsions and toxic psychosis. Furthermore, the potential for serious and sometimes fatal anaphylactic reactions and metabolic disturbances like hypoglycemia that can progress to coma mandates swift action.

Patients must seek immediate medical attention for any severe symptom, including difficulty breathing or signs of severe CNS effects. The medicine must be discontinued immediately upon the first sign of a severe allergic reaction.

Management is strictly symptomatic and supportive, as no specific chemical antidote is known. Procedures such as gastric lavage or forced diuresis may be considered, and continuous observation is required due to the risk of symptom progression. Resuscitation procedures should be administered as indicated by the patient’s clinical status.

What should I know about interactions with other medicines?

Interactions with other medicines and products

The official regulatory profile for Galusan (Pipemidic Acid) identifies several clinically significant interactions based on pharmacokinetic and pharmacodynamic findings.

Formal Co-administration Restrictions

Co-administration with corticosteroids (e.g., hydrocortisone, prednisolone) is officially restricted due to an increased risk of tendinopathy (tendon damage), a risk noted as higher in the elderly population and patients with kidney failure. Combination with agents that prolong the QTc interval is also restricted, as it is documented to increase the risk or severity of heart rhythm disorders.

Exposure and Timing Constraints

Galusan is officially documented to interfere with the metabolism of certain co-administered drugs, including acetaminophen and axitinib, resulting in increased systemic exposure of those medicines. Furthermore, products containing polyvalent cations (such as certain antacids) are officially found to reduce the absorption of Galusan, potentially decreasing its efficacy. This pharmacokinetic interference necessitates a timing separation of the dose, typically requiring administration at least two hours before or two hours after the polyvalent cation-containing product.

Pharmacodynamic Interactions

Documented pharmacodynamic interactions include an officially noted potentiation with Non-Steroidal Anti-Inflammatory Drugs (NSAIDs), which may increase the medicine’s neuroexcitatory activities. Additionally, the therapeutic efficacy of the BCG vaccine is officially documented as being decreased when co-administered.

Mechanism of Action

How Galusan Works: Mechanism of Action


Targeted Blockade of Bacterial Genetic Machinery

The drug's active ingredient, Pipemidic Acid, acts as an inhibitor by targeting two essential bacterial enzymes: DNA Gyrase (Topoisomerase II) and Topoisomerase IV. The molecule specifically binds to these enzymes and stabilizes a transient complex with the cleaved bacterial DNA. This stabilization prevents the necessary re-ligation of the DNA strands, thereby obstructing the enzymes' function in DNA replication and chromosome segregation.


Induction of Lethal Bactericidal Cascade

This molecular interaction converts the targets into destructive agents, initiating a physiological cascade defined by active DNA fragmentation. The resultant irreparable double-strand DNA breaks quickly overwhelm the bacterial cell's repair mechanisms, resulting in bacterial cell death via a bactericidal mechanism. This action contributes to the reduction of the bacterial load in the affected system.


Constraint by Target Modification and Efflux

This mechanism is intrinsically constrained by structural changes, primarily mutations in the gyrA and parC genes which alter the enzyme binding site, reducing drug affinity. It is also limited by bacterial efflux pumps that actively prevent the molecule from reaching the necessary inhibitory concentrations inside the cell.

Dosage and Administration Information

How to Use Galusan

The administration of Galusan, whose active substance is Pipemidic Acid, is based on the usage principles outlined in official documents. As a quinolone antibacterial agent, its use is standardized to ensure the correct concentration is achieved over a defined course of treatment.


Official Administration Guidelines

Instruction Detail
Route of Administration Oral (PO). The medicine is formulated as a tablet or capsule for systemic delivery via ingestion.
Dosing Schedule 400 mg per dose. This is the standard strength and quantity for administration in adults.
Frequency Twice daily (BID), meaning the dose is administered every 12 hours.
Timing in relation to meals The administration is directed to occur after meals (post-prandial).
Course Duration Treatment should be short-term, typically lasting at least five days but not exceeding ten days for a complete course.

Procedural Context and Constraints

The protocol establishes Galusan as a fixed-duration oral treatment. Each dose must be taken with a full glass of water, and patients are advised to stay well-hydrated throughout the entire treatment period. Use of the medicine is generally contraindicated in children and adolescents during the growth phase, defining a usage profile restricted to the adult population. The official protocol also restricts use in patients with severe dysfunction, such as severe renal or hepatic disease, as detailed in official prescribing information.

Q: Is Galusan an anti-inflammatory drug?

Galusan, which contains Pipemidic Acid, is classified by official regulatory bodies as a Quinolone Antibacterial Agent. Its primary mechanism of action is focused on fighting bacterial infections by inhibiting bacterial DNA enzymes. The official drug labels and therapeutic classifications do not list anti-inflammatory action as a primary use or pharmacological property.


Q: What should I do if I miss a dose of Galusan?

Specific guidance on a missed dose is included in the Patient Information Leaflet. If the dose is remembered, the general guidance provided in the Patient Information Leaflet suggests taking it as soon as it is remembered. If it is close to the time for the next scheduled dose, the leaflet generally advises skipping the missed dose, but it is important not to take a double dose to make up for a missed one.


Q: Should I avoid any food while taking Galusan?

Official information notes that products containing polyvalent cations (such as certain antacids or mineral supplements) have been found to significantly reduce the absorption of Galusan. For this reason, official labeling typically advises a time separation between the administration of Galusan and these cation-containing products. Galusan should otherwise be taken after meals.


Q: Can Galusan be used during pregnancy or breastfeeding?

Official information regarding use during pregnancy advises that it should generally be avoided as a precautionary measure. For lactation (breastfeeding), the decision requires a careful consideration of the potential benefits versus any risk to the infant, as the drug's transfer into human milk may be limited.
